The neutrino floor at ultra-low threshold

Published 4 Apr 2016 in astro-ph.CO and hep-ph | (1604.00729v1)

Abstract: By lowering their energy threshold direct dark matter searches can reach the neutrino floor with experimental technology now in development. The 7Be flux can be detected with $\sim 10$ eV nuclear recoil energy threshold and 50 kg-yr exposure. The pep flux can be detected with $\sim 3$ ton-yr exposure, and the first detection of the CNO flux is possible with similar exposure. The pp flux can be detected with threshold of $\sim$ eV and only $\sim$ kg-yr exposure. These can be the first pure neutral current measurements of the low-energy solar neutrino flux. Measuring this flux is important for low mass dark matter searches and for understanding the solar interior.
